Vegan Month: HECK Bollywood Bangers and Sweet Fusion Sausages *

Today is part 2 of my vegan HECK sausage reviews. Yes they have been beavering away the last four years to create 4 new plant based sausages and last week I reviewed their The Beet Goes On & Super Green Saus, and today it is the turn of the HECK Bollywood Bangers and Sweet Fusion Sausages. With the seal of approval for being vegetarian and vegan, these high fibre sausages are £3.00 a pack and can be found in Asda. Bepps Black Eyed Pea Puff Snacks

There is a new snack onboard the snack train and are in fact the first of its kind. But what are they? Bepps Black Eyed Pea Puff Snacks is what they are, and they are the UK’s first range of black eyed pea puffs. Currently these come in three flavours Sweet Chilli, Sea Salt and Black Pepper and Cheese and are in the most vibrant and funky packaging.  You can buy these singularly in stores, as a taster pack or bigger boxes of single flavours over on their website.
